Sander Tool: Let Loose the Power of Smooth Surfaces

What is a Sander Tool?

A sander tool is a power tool created to ravel surfaces by abrasion. It uses sandpaper or rough discs to get rid of rough sides, paint, varnish, or various other flaws from various materials. Whether you're refinishing furnishings, bring back wood floors, or prepping surface areas for paint, a sander tool is an essential buddy in attaining the excellent shine.

How Can a Sander Tool Transform Your Polishing Results?

Incorporating a sander tool into your polishing routine deals many benefits:

Efficient Material Removal: A sander tool can rapidly and efficiently remove old coatings, enabling you to begin with a fresh start for polishing.

Uniform Surface Preparation: By raveling surface areas, a sander tool makes certain an also application of polish or protective finishes, resulting in a consistent shine.

Time and Power Savings: Fining sand by hand can be labor-intensive and taxing. A sander tool automates the procedure, decreasing exhaustion and accelerating your sprucing up projects.

Expert Tip: When using a sander tool, constantly begin with a crude grit sandpaper and slowly transfer to finer grits for a smoother finish. This step-by-step strategy lessens the threat of damaging the surface area and makes certain optimum results.

Polishing Tool: Releasing the Power of Brilliance

What is a Polishing Tool?

A polishing tool is particularly created to highlight the sparkle in various products by eliminating flaws and enhancing their appearance. These tools make use of rough materials, such as polishing pads or discs, in addition to specialized substances or polishes to achieve extraordinary outcomes. From metal surfaces to automobile surfaces, a polishing tool is an indispensable asset in your pursuit for brilliance.

How Can a Polishing Tool Transform Your Surfaces?

Incorporating a polishing tool right into your routine deals several transformative benefits:

Revitalized Surface areas: A polishing tool can eliminate scrapes, swirl marks, and oxidation, breathing new life into dull or broken surfaces.

Enhanced Reflectivity: By eliminating blemishes and restoring clearness, a polishing tool can significantly improve the reflectivity of surface areas, giving you that coveted mirror-like shine.

Versatile Applications: From fashion jewelry to furniture and whatever in between, a polishing tool can be utilized on different products, making it a functional addition to your toolkit.

Expert Tip: Trying out various compounds and brightening pads to find the excellent combination for your particular polishing needs. Bear in mind to begin with less rough substances and gradually increase the strength as necessary.
